Al Jazeera correspondents report a widespread series of Israeli airstrikes and drone attacks targeting Tyre, Nabatieh, the Beqaa Valley, and several other Lebanese towns.
According to breaking alerts from Al Jazeera—a Qatari state-funded network that extensively covers regional conflicts and generally centers Arab and Palestinian perspectives—a sweeping series of Israeli airstrikes targeted numerous towns in southern and eastern Lebanon on March 9. These reports were widely re-broadcast by Wahid Iraq, an Iraqi channel whose editorial stance routinely aligns with the regional Axis of Resistance.
Throughout the day, Al Jazeera correspondents on the ground reported continuous bombardments across southern Lebanon. Notably, a raid by an Israeli drone struck Al-Housh in the Tyre district, while a separate Israeli raid hit Tyre directly.
The strikes were heavily concentrated on southern towns and districts. Al Jazeera reporters documented specific Israeli raids targeting: Arnoun The vicinity of Majdal Selm in the Marjeyoun district Qabrikha and Taybeh Adchit
